Cryptolepis by Ortho Molecular Products – Botanical Support for Immune and Microbial Balance

Cryptolepis by Ortho Molecular Products is an herbal liquid supplement derived from Cryptolepis sanguinolenta, a plant traditionally found in Ghana and other regions of Africa. It is designed to help support the body's natural defenses against immune challenges, maintain normal inflammatory balance, and support microbial balance, and it provides antioxidant support.

Cryptolepis is often used in conjunction with Cat's Claw, Japanese Knotweed, Andrographis, and Sweet Wormwood as part of a comprehensive approach to maintaining microbial balance and supporting a healthy immune response.

How Cryptolepis Works

Spirochetes are bacteria commonly associated with tick exposure that are often accompanied by other associated microbes that can make maintaining microbial balance especially challenging. Cryptolepis and its primary alkaloid, cryptolepine, have demonstrated microbial-balancing activity in laboratory research, including activity against both actively growing and non-growing stationary-phase spirochete populations.

Cryptolepis root contains alkaloids, tannins, and flavones and has a long history of traditional use as an herb to support the immune system and help maintain microbial and inflammatory balance. It is frequently combined with other botanicals such as Cat's Claw, Japanese Knotweed, Andrographis, and Sweet Wormwood for a comprehensive approach to microbial balance and immune support.

Recommendation: Mix 1 full dropper (0.7 mL, approximately 25-30 drops) with 2 fluid ounces of water, twice per day, or as recommended by your health care professional.

Serving Size: 1 Dropper (0.7 mL)
Servings Per Container: About 80

Amount Per Serving:
Cryptolepis sanguinolenta Root Extract (1:5) ... 0.7 mL

Storage: Store tightly closed in a cool, dry place away from heat and moisture, out of reach of children.

Warnings/Cautions: If you are pregnant or nursing, or have a medical condition, consult your healthcare practitioner before using this product. As with all dietary supplements, some individuals may not tolerate or may be allergic to the ingredients used; discontinue use and consult your physician if you experience negative reactions.

Frequently Asked Questions About Cryptolepis

What are the benefits of Cryptolepis?

Cryptolepis provides a concentrated liquid extract of Cryptolepis sanguinolenta root for botanical support of immune defenses and microbial balance. The root naturally contains cryptolepine and related alkaloids, along with tannins and flavones that contribute to its traditional use. A liquid delivery form allows the labelled 0.7 mL amount to be mixed with water according to the manufacturer’s directions. The product’s benefits center on maintaining a balanced response to everyday microbial challenges, supporting normal inflammatory signaling, and contributing antioxidant activity. Cryptolepis is often selected within a practitioner-designed botanical programme rather than used as a general multivitamin. Its focused ingredient profile also makes the source of the botanical activity clear when a clinician is evaluating response and tolerance.
